What Is a Bank Confirmation Letter? A bank confirmation letter, commonly abbreviated as BCL, serves as an essential tool in various business transactions to confirm the existence of a loan or line of credit extended by a banking institution to its customer. Introduction to Assumable Mortgages An assumable mortgage represents a unique financing arrangement where a homebuyer assumes responsibility for an outstanding mortgage and its terms instead of obtaining their own loan.
